Role Summary

The Specialist, Client Management plays a critical role in advancing the success of our biopharma partners and supporting McKesson's integrated specialty pharmacy model. As the primary point of contact for key client programs, you will support end to end program operations, drive continuous improvement, and ensure delivery excellence across multiple business lines.

This role is ideal for a forward thinking, analytically minded relationship builder who proactively identifies opportunities, solves problems with cross functional partners, and ensures that our clients experience seamless, high-quality service.

What You'll Do

Client & Relationship Management

  • Serve as a main point of contact for assigned pharmaceutical clients, ensuring clear, consistent, and proactive communication.
  • Drive strong client engagement by providing consultative insights, identifying workflow improvements, and highlighting opportunities for program and revenue growth.

  • Prepare and deliver Quarterly Business Reviews that showcase results, trends, and strategic recommendations.

Program & Project Management

  • Manage day to day program operations, timelines, and deliverables for cross functional teams (Quality, Pharmacy Services, Legal, Finance, BI, Marketing, and more).
  • Track performance against service level agreements; identify gaps and lead corrective action planning.
  • Oversee the change request process and maintain project plans, tracking logs, and relevant documentation.
  • Validate reporting accuracy and interpret results to provide meaningful, actionable insights to clients.

Financial & Contract Oversight

  • Monitor program profitability and provide monthly variance commentary when needed.
  • Review, validate, and manage the accuracy of all client billing activities in partnership with Finance.
  • Support pricing and contract modification activities for new and existing client initiatives.

Internal Collaboration & Leadership

  • Foster a strong team environment and support effective communication across the Client Relationship organization.
  • Escalate risks or issues appropriately and ensure leadership visibility into program operations.
  • Contribute to a culture of continuous improvement by challenging the status quo and recommending innovative solutions.
